Brief Summary
Prospective observational study designed to implement a daily monitoring of microcirculation and tissue oxygenation in all critically ill patients admitted to the ICU in the period of nine months, in order to assess the prevalence of microvascular perfusion abnormalities and their relation to: outcomes, underlying disease, hospital stay, clinical-laboratory and hemodynamic parameters commonly measured, indices of clinical severity and predictors of mortality , therapeutic interventions that are part of routine clinical practice (fluids, sedation, vasopressors, inotropes, anticoagulants, renal replacement therapy, blood transfusion). The study also includes the evaluation of sublingual microcirculation and tissue oxygenation in 30 healthy volunteers to compare normal and pathological conditions. Within the first 12 hours after admission to ICU and every 24 hours for the duration of hospitalization, the following evaluations will be made: -study of sublingual microcirculation using sidestream dark field (SDF) imaging, muscle tissue oxygenation using near infrared spectroscopy (NIRS). The data will be analyzed to test correlation between the outcome of patients admitted in ICU and microcirculatory parameters.

Outcome Measures
Primary Outcomes (2)
Correlation between changes in perfused vessel density and 90 days mortality from ICU admission
The perfused vessel density (PVD) is defined as the quantity (mm/mmq) of microcirculatory vessels which have a good flow and it is calculated using a dedicated software described elsewhere.
90 days
Correlation between changes in StO2 upload and 90 days mortality from ICU admission
During vascular occlusion test, the changes of StO2 and StO2 values can divided into 3 epoch; Desaturation (StO2 download), Reoxygenation (StO2 upload), and Reactive hyperemia. After data collection, the rate of desaturation and reoxygenation are calculated.
90 days

Eligibility Criteria
Adult patients admitted in intensive care unit
You may qualify if:
- adult patients admitted in ICU
You may not qualify if:
- age \<18
- expected ICU length of stay \<24 hrs
- any conditions that preclude sublingual microcirculatory evaluation (e.g. facial trauma)
- readmitted patients previously enrolled in the present study
